Time is a factor.
Car key programming is a specialized process that involves aligning the key's digital signature to your car's computer system. This ensures that only the right key is used to unlock your car and start it. It also prevents the unauthorized entry and theft of your car. If you lose your key or if it breaks, you need to find an auto locksmith key programming locksmith to create a new key for you. The procedure can take a long time but it's well worth it if you want to keep your vehicle safe from thieves.
Modern cars are equipped with advanced electronic anti-theft system that rely on a unique keys to connect with the car's computer. They have transponders that transmit a code when you insert them into the ignition. If you don't have a correctly programmed key, the engine will not start and the vehicle will be inoperable. The process of programming keys for cars can take up to one hour, based on your vehicle's make, model and age.
In order to preprogram your key, you will require the proper tools and know-how to do it right. Certain cars are more difficult to work on, and others require a specific tool known as a "dealer programmer." These tools can cost a lot and must be purchased by an automotive locksmith that has the proper credentials. Doing the job yourself could cause damage to your vehicle's electronic components.

The majority of modern cars come with transponder chips that are found in the key's head or in the remote control fob. They contain an unique number that is required to begin the car. They also allow you to unlock the doors and disable the alarm system. If the chips are damaged, they'll need to be replaced with a new one in order to function effectively.
